About the Role

As the Registered Manager, you will hold the key responsibility for the day-to-day management of the home. Your leadership will ensure that we deliver a high-quality level of care, promoting the rights of young people and supporting their transitions into adulthood.

Main Responsibilities

  • Service and Practice: Develop and deliver high-quality care in line with relevant legislation and organizational policies.
  • Human Resource Management: Recruit, supervise, and appraise staff, ensuring continuous professional development.
  • Management of Resources: Monitor the service budget and maintain the premises and equipment.
  • External Affairs: Promote the organization positively and liaise with external agencies and professionals.

Key Duties

  • Lead a team of care workers to achieve positive outcomes for young people.
  • Maintain accurate records and implement monitoring systems.
  • Chair meetings and oversee admissions and discharges.
  • Innovate and lead change in line with our organizational ethos.
  • Take on-call responsibilities and cover sleep-in shifts as needed.

What We’re Looking For

  • Enthusiasm for providing the highest quality care and education.
  • Experience in managing a team.
  • Comprehensive knowledge of child protection and safeguarding procedures.
  • A relevant Diploma Level 5 or equivalent (or willingness to work towards it).

Working Conditions

This is a full-time, permanent position requiring 39 hours per week. Some office days will be necessary for administrative duties, and sleep-in duties will be scheduled as per the home’s rota.

Compensation and Benefits

  • Competitive salary of up to £64,280 (including Ofsted and occupancy bonuses).
  • 25 days of annual leave plus 8 statutory holidays.
  • £3,000 bonus for an outstanding Ofsted report.
  • Full occupancy bonus of £600 per month.
  • On-call payments: £25 on weekdays, £35 on weekends.
  • Pension scheme in line with organizational and government guidelines.
  • Petrol allowance for using your own car (proof of business insurance required).
